<strong>Syria</strong> may <strong>in</strong> general be considered as 3 mounta<strong>in</strong>ous country;<br />

but <strong>the</strong> part border<strong>in</strong>g on Jaffa has several<br />

very<br />

extensive pla<strong>in</strong>s,<br />

which are <strong>in</strong>tersected, at certa<strong>in</strong> distances, with moderate heights.<br />

In approach<strong>in</strong>g Jerusalem, after side of Ramia,<br />

hav<strong>in</strong>g proceeded to <strong>the</strong> o<strong>the</strong>r<br />

<strong>the</strong> mounta<strong>in</strong>s are very lofty, <strong>and</strong>, hav<strong>in</strong>g but a<br />

slender superficies<br />

of earth to cover <strong>the</strong>ir rocky prom<strong>in</strong>ences, are<br />

exclusively adapted to <strong>the</strong> cultivation of olive-trees, which take root<br />

<strong>in</strong> <strong>the</strong>ir very clefts, <strong>and</strong> hide <strong>the</strong> naked appearance <strong>the</strong>y would<br />

o<strong>the</strong>rwise exhibit.<br />

In general <strong>the</strong> country is but th<strong>in</strong>ly covered with trees, <strong>and</strong><br />

has few woods, or thickets. In <strong>the</strong> parts where <strong>the</strong>re is no tex-<br />

ture of soil, but merely a white loose s<strong>and</strong>, not a tree nor shrub is<br />

to be seen.<br />

From <strong>the</strong> <strong>in</strong>formation I was able to collect, as well as from my<br />

own personal observation, I could not learn that ei<strong>the</strong>r m<strong>in</strong>es or<br />

eruptions of volcanic matter are to be met with <strong>in</strong> <strong>Syria</strong>.<br />

The soil <strong>in</strong> many parts, <strong>in</strong> those more especially border<strong>in</strong>g on <strong>the</strong><br />

<strong>desert</strong>s, consists almost exclusively of a f<strong>in</strong>e white s<strong>and</strong>, <strong>the</strong> reflec-<br />

tion from which is extremely pa<strong>in</strong>ful to <strong>the</strong> sight. This barren<br />

territory extends, to <strong>the</strong> northward, beyond Jaffa. It conta<strong>in</strong>s,<br />

however, <strong>in</strong> common with <strong>the</strong> o<strong>the</strong>r parts of <strong>Syria</strong>, several fer-<br />

tile spots, covered with a rich black mould, which very copiously<br />

repay <strong>the</strong> labour bestowed on <strong>the</strong>m. On <strong>the</strong> rocky grounds an<br />

<strong>in</strong>considerable portion of calcareous earth is found blended with<br />

marl.<br />

Wherever <strong>the</strong> l<strong>and</strong> is susceptible of cultivation, <strong>and</strong> has not<br />

been neglected, it affords abundant crops of wheat, barley,. Indian<br />

corn (dourra), tobacco, cotton, <strong>and</strong> o<strong>the</strong>r productions. Fruits <strong>and</strong><br />

vegetables are <strong>in</strong> equal abundance. Among <strong>the</strong> former are pome-<br />

granates, figs, oranges, lemons, citrons of an uncommonly large<br />

size, melons, grapes, <strong>and</strong> olives. The melons are large,<br />
